How to play poker in a casino: Rules and tips
Playing poker in a casino environment can be both exciting and challenging. Understanding the basic rules and strategies is essential for anyone looking to improve their chances of winning. Whether you are a beginner or have some experience, knowing the casino poker etiquette and gameplay structure will help you feel more confident at the table.
In a casino, poker games generally follow standard rules, including hand rankings and betting rounds. Players are dealt a set number of cards, and the goal is to create the best possible hand or bluff your way to victory. It’s important to observe other players’ behavior and betting patterns to make informed decisions. Proper bankroll management and patience are key strategies to avoid unnecessary losses while optimizing your play.
